Ticket: Staging env misconfigured for Siftgate bloom filter

The bloom layer in front of the Pellet KV store is rejecting all lookups in staging because the env file was copied from the dev template without credentials. False-positive tuning values are fine; only the auth line is missing. To unblock the weekly demo, the Pellet admission secret must be set on the following line.

env line for yaguf-fajop: LEDGER_TOKEN13=fb08984397349

Runbook — account recovery for Soundmoss. Hi, new contractor! The waveform-preview service renders audio thumbnails, and its worker account occasionally gets locked when the render queue backs up and auth retries trip the limiter. Recovery is simple: drain the queue from the ops console, then re-enable the worker account through the recovery tool. The tool will ask you to authenticate with the team's recovery passphrase, which you'll find directly below this paragraph.

unlock words, yawig-kagef: gordor-holvan-ulaael-pramir-ulaiel-tamdor

## Authentication

The `extract-strings` script pushes extracted translation strings to LexiQueue, our internal localization intake service. Authentication is a single API key passed in the request header; no OAuth flow is involved. The key is scoped to the `release-strings` namespace only, so it cannot modify approved translations. Release managers running the script outside CI should export the staging key shown below before invoking it.

service key, tadup-tahog: zpat7_wB1tnEL

Capacity note for the Bramblewick export retry queue. Failed exports are requeued with exponential backoff, and the queue depth is our main capacity signal: sustained depth above the high-water mark means downstream Pellis storage is saturated, not that we need more workers. As the new contractor, please don't raise worker counts without checking storage latency first — it usually makes things worse. Retry timing, backoff caps, and the high-water threshold are all driven by the constants shown below.

limits module of yagef-bajog:
TIERS = {
    "druael": 370,
    "tamix": 286,
    "pelius": 541,
    "pelael": 78,
    "pelox": 47,
    "ralath": 533,
    "drumir": 801,
}